Responsibilities
The professional will be responsible for defining the strategic positioning of products within the Retail segment, ensuring alignment with business objectives and market trends. This role involves planning and managing the entire product lifecycle, from product launch to end‑of‑life or discontinuation, with a strong focus on operational execution and performance monitoring.
Collaboration with the marketing and sales team will be essential to support the development of digital content and oversee its implementation, ensuring consistent brand presence and customer engagement.
The professional will also conduct ongoing research on competitor products, pricing strategies, and market positioning, providing insights that support decision‑making and portfolio optimization.
Additionally, the role includes supporting the planning and execution of initiatives to achieve and exceed revenue, sales volume, and market share targets. The professional will identify opportunities for portfolio improvement and expansion, while analyzing competitor behavior, market dynamics, and customer needs to anticipate trends and strengthen competitiveness.
Finally, the position will provide operational support in planning, tracking, and monitoring the company’s quarterly PL, contributing to the achievement of financial and strategic goals.
Requirements
Completed higher education (Bachelor’s degree).
Graduate studies will be considered a differential (Postgraduate studies will be considered an advantage).
Required experience of 5 to 6 years in the field.
Advanced English – will be tested in the interview.
Intermediate Spanish – will be tested in the interview.
Advanced Excel / Power BI.
Experience in preparing presentations for senior leadership.
